Euro Tech Begin Period Cash Flow yearly trend continues to be comparatively stable with very little volatility. Begin Period Cash Flow will likely drop to about 5.5 M in 2025. Begin Period Cash Flow is the amount of cash Euro Tech Holdings has at the beginning of a financial reporting period. It serves as the starting point for calculating the period's cash flow from operations, investing, and financing activities. View All Fundamentals

About Euro Tech Financial Statements

Euro Tech shareholders use historical fundamental indicators, such as Begin Period Cash Flow, to determine how well the company is positioned to perform in the future. Although Euro Tech investors may analyze each financial statement separately, they are all interrelated. The changes in Euro Tech's assets and liabilities, for example, are also reflected in the revenues and expenses on on Euro Tech's income statement.
